GT 28's Info/ Advice
Just got my new toy. An 03 tt x50 with GT28's,60lb injectors, Proto Tune, Diverters, Proto Intake tract, Evoms air filter, Headers, Muffler,Greddy Profec 2, LWFW, Sachs stage 4. Stock FPR.
Car runs great and pulls strong at 1.2 bar. Have not gone higher at this point. Todds tune has the AFR's around the 12 range during acceleration according to the Brockway.
My question,With turbo technology changing almost every other month. Where do these turbos fit in the " Turbo Performance Ladder"compared to k24/18's, Alpha 28's ect that several of other board members are currently using.
Just trying to know where they fit in and what success people have had with them. Also what set up's and boost levels can be expected with these turbos. Already used to the power at 1.2 and looking for a little more.....
I will be using this car for a weekend driver. Looking for quick spool and max safe HP with stock block on race fuel . ( Arn't we all)

WHos car is that? I know most of the proto cars... are your turbos Gt28/K16 direct replacement? Or are they real gt28s...
Technology changes- I agree... but it doesn't mean it always works...
Certain turbos work well on specific cars... meanwhile on others they simply do not...
each tuner has his own way of doing things.. but boost for boost a 18g probably is in the same league as a real gt28. You probably have the 28s stuffed in a K16 housing.... thats what chokes up the car.... small hot housing....
